For years I had a team... The McCann Team. My definition of a team is entirely different than yours (Kenneth's).
We were a great team and it worked well.
My team included my wife who was licensed and then iced it and just did admin duties so she could completely control her schedule and the kids.
I had two Lenders on board, a Title Company, two Home Inspectors, a repair company, and my true Ace in the Hole...my two young kids who countless times procured business for us at church, school, Chamber of Commerce events, etc. They also were great babysitters for clients children and my daughter still may be called upon to help out.
My son now does the computer work for me at my Land Auctions and is a software develpoer!
I just shake my head and laugh when I hear comments that you need a team...or teams don't work...or teams are great or teams might have inexperienced agents.
They all are true...and we all market to our strengths. So if you have a team...you believe in their concept; if you are a single agent...you believe in your concept.
And I am certain of one fact: We are all just trying to make a living, ehh?
